China in numbers
| Official name | People's Republic of China |
|---|---|
| Capital | Beijing |
| Region | Eastern Asia, Asia |
| Population | 1,402,112,000 |
| Area | 9,706,961 km² · 144 people per km² |
| Currency | Chinese yuan (CNY) |
| Languages | Chinese |
| Country codes | CN · CHN · .cn |
| Coastline | Has a coast |
Things worth knowing
- All of China operates on Beijing Time (UTC+8), despite spanning 5 natural time zones.
- The Yangtze is the longest river entirely within one country — 6,300 km.
- China has 56 officially recognized ethnic groups; Han are ~91% of the population.
Did you know
The Great Wall is not one wall but a network of walls built over 2,000 years — its total length exceeds 21,000 km.
